This bracelet used 6mm round mirror beads and 6mm pearls from Cousin. I used a multi-strand clasp with hook and extender chain to be able to give it versatility. This piece was a whole lot of making links and connecting those links, but the finished bracelet is awesome! And of course, I made earrings to match!

How's This for A Contest Piece?
A few weeks ago I mentioned that I was going to step out of my comfort zone in 2011. Well, I'm happy to announce I've finished a piece to enter in the Happy Mango Beads - Bead My Valentine contest.
In looking at all the themes and categories in which contest entries will be judged, I chose "Roses are Red, Violets are Blue - FLOWERS!!!" Yes, flowers speak to me. If you've seen some of my jewelry over the summer months, you'll notice I use lots of flower as props. From Zinnias to Morning Glories and BOATLOADS of daylilies I just love how they provide a rainbow of color and happiness.
So for me, the theme of flowers was perfect!
I used a handpainted ceramic bead that I had been hoarding as a focal. Using a circular brick stich, I created petals in a mix of delicas with small pink crystals forming the petals. For the necklace I stitched 2 leaves using the same mix of delicas. I added a few pearls and fire polished czech glass beads for a bit more color & sparkle and kept the rest of the chain simple.
The necklace wears beautifully flat against your collar bones and makes a statement without being heavy. It's actually very lightweight! So while I'm still trying to get the "perfect" photo to e-mail in, I'll leave you with a few that really do show the detail and coloring!
